Pros

You get the industry wide acceptance that you are working for a great company. It is easy to move from one job to another with in the company easily as the company has lot openings internally.

Cons

Other than getting the Oracle name on your resume, technical knowledge gaining opportunities are limited. I agree with the some of reviews about Oracle regarding "Quantity" Vs "Quality": Management is always expects more output than people can deliver, so in order to deliver members deliver buggy non-quality products. When you join oracle, one thing you can say good bye to is "work life balance". Management in the company assumes that Saturday/Sunday is also working days.
